Version 3.80 however does promise to bring something pretty cool - streaming internet radio. The update will allow the PSP to pick up streams of online radio broadcasts in the same format that it supports such as Shoutcast MP3 streams. The upgrade will also expand its feed-reading capabilities the ability to pick up “photocasts” from RSS feeds. It will also allow users to import OPML feed lists from other feed readers to import the same feeds on the handheld console.

Another recent firmware upgrade helped improve navigation through videos by scrolling through scenes in a timeline, and now that will be even more granular in version 3.80 with the ability to scroll through individual scenes. If you happen to live in Japan or any other place with 1Seg broadcasting you can also hook up your 1seg antenna and use the PSP as a DVR. That feature is way cool but unfortunately useless to us here in the states.

Japan is expected to get the 3.80 firmware upgrade on December 18th and it applies to both the fat and slim versions of the PSP.
